Saturn Aura Investigated By NHTSA For Faulty Transmission Shift Cable

Derek Kreindler
by Derek Kreindler

NHTSA is ramping up its investigation into the Saturn Aura after numerous complaints of the vehicle moving while in park or accelerating in the opposite direction to which the driver intended.

A total of 33 complaints have been received by NHTSA and GM combined, covering both 2007 and 2008 model Auras. So far, an engineering analysis is underway, but this is considered a step on the way to a full recall of the vehicles. One incident saw an Aura driver place the car in park and exit the vehicle, only to be struck by the car as it rolled backwards. The recall could affect as many as 65,000 cars.
